Country Brand Manager (Adult Vaccines)
About this opportunity
Role Description
The Country Brand Manager, Adult Vaccines, supports the Marketing Lead and Country Brand Lead in executing local Adult Vaccines initiatives. The role is responsible for coordinating tactical plans, customer engagement activities, omnichannel programs, field-force enablement, budget tracking, and approved material deployment in line with the overall brand direction.
Ensures that all activities are conducted in accordance with company policies and SOPs, Pfizer values, and global guidelines (including MAPP, FCPA), as appropriate.
This is an execution-focused role. The incumbent will contribute insights and implementation feedback but will not be primarily accountable for overall brand strategy, brand plan ownership, or long-range portfolio direction.
Key Responsibilities
The role supports the delivery of agreed Adult Vaccines priorities through strong planning discipline, stakeholder coordination, and timely execution of local initiatives.
Support translation of brand direction into local tactical plans, execution timelines, and implementation trackers.
Coordinate approved HCP, patient, customer engagement, omnichannel, and educational initiatives.
Support development, review, approval routing, and deployment of promotional materials, training resources, FAQs, and field tools.
Track A&P budget, purchase orders, activity spend, KPIs, and agreed performance indicators.
Prepare activity updates, execution summaries, and follow-up actions for review with the Marketing Lead and Country Brand Lead.
Coordinate with field teams, Medical, Regulatory, Legal, Compliance, Supply, Finance, and other relevant stakeholders to ensure execution readiness.
Support field-force enablement through training coordination, material deployment, field feedback consolidation, and implementation support.
Ensure all activities are executed in accordance with company policies, SOPs, Pfizer values, and applicable compliance requirements.

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E
Qualifications:
Minimum 5 years of pharmaceutical or healthcare industry experience, preferably with at least 3 years in marketing, commercial execution, or related roles.
Bachelor's Degree or equivalent required.
Experience in marketing execution, customer engagement, project coordination, or field-force support within the healthcare industry.
Strong execution mindset with good attention to detail, follow-through, and ability to work across matrix teams.
